Illinois Racing Board met Jan. 20

Illinois Racing Board met Jan. 20.

Here are the minutes provided by the board:

A regular meeting of the Illinois Racing Board was held at 555 W. Monroe, Chicago, Illinois and via WebEx Audio Conferencing starting at 10:00 a.m. The following Board members participated: Chairman Dan Beiser, Commissioners Leslie Breuer Jr, Marcus Davis, Beth Doria, Lydia Gray, Alan Henry, Charles MacKelvie, Benjamin Reyes, Leslye Sandberg and John Stephan. Staff members Domenic DiCera (JRTC), John Gay (JRTC), Bob Denneen (JRTC), Michael Belmonte, and Donald Marquez also participated

LICENSEE REQUESTS:

Commissioner Reyes moved for approval of race officials at Fairmount Park, Inc for calendar year 2022. Commissioner Davis seconded the motion. The motion passed unanimously (10-0) by roll call vote.

Commissioner Breuer moved for approval of race officials at Suburban Downs, Inc for calendar year 2022. Commissioner Gray seconded the motion. The motion passed unanimously (10-0) by roll call vote.

Commissioner Davis moved for approval of the following contracting goals for 2022 for organization licensees pursuant to Section 12.2 of the Illinois Horse Racing Act. Minority owned businesses – 11%, Female owned businesses – 7%, Businesses owned by persons with disabilities – 2%. Commissioner Sandberg seconded the motion. The motion passed unanimously (10-0) by roll call vote.

Commissioner Reyes moved to certify the following recapture amounts for calendar year 2022. Hawthorne Race Course Thoroughbred $ 3,282,986, Hawthorne Race Course Harness $ 1,873,922, Fairmount Park Thoroughbred $ 1,889,347, Fairmount Park Illinois Colt Stakes Fund $ 22,224 for a total 2022 recapture amount of $ 7,068,479 Commissioner Doria seconded the motion. The motion passed unanimously (10-0) by roll call vote

Commissioner Davis moved for approval of an intertrack wagering license at Hawthorne Race Course, Inc for calendar year 2022. Commissioner Henry seconded the motion. The motion passed (10-0) by roll call vote.

Commissioner Sandberg moved for approval of occupation licensees to operate as concessionaires for calendar year 2022. Commissioner MacKelvie seconded the motion. The motion passed unanimously (10-0) by roll call vote.

Commissioner Reyes moved for approval to vacate four live racing days in February 2022 at Suburban Downs, Inc. Commissioner Breuer seconded the motion. The motion passed unanimously (10-0) by roll call vote.

APPROVAL OF MINUTES

Commissioner Doria moved to approve the minutes of the December 16, 2021 board meeting. Commissioner Sandberg seconded the motion. The motion passed unanimously (10-0) by roll call vote.

ADJOURMENT

At 10:45 AM., Commissioner Davis moved to adjourn the meeting. Commissioner MacKelvie seconded the motion. The motion passed unanimously (10-0) by roll call vote.
